What contributions to women's rights advocacy is associated with Emmeline Pankhurst? 🔊
Emmeline Pankhurst is renowned for her pivotal role in the women's suffrage movement in the UK. As the founder of the Women's Social and Political Union (WSPU), she advocated for women's right to vote through both peaceful protest and more militant strategies. Her dedication to the cause inspired countless women to join the movement, galvanizing public attention and support. Pankhurst’s focus on direct action, including hunger strikes and demonstrations, exemplified her belief in the necessity of sacrifice for social change. Her legacy continues, as her efforts laid the groundwork for future advancements in women's rights and gender equality.
